forked from axiom-team/jaklis
Don't crash when score is 0
This commit is contained in:
parent
26ecee37d9
commit
236de7092c
|
@ -51,12 +51,7 @@ class ReadLikes:
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
document = json.dumps(data)
|
return json.dumps(data)
|
||||||
|
|
||||||
# print(document)
|
|
||||||
# sys.exit(0)
|
|
||||||
|
|
||||||
return document
|
|
||||||
|
|
||||||
def sendDocument(self, document):
|
def sendDocument(self, document):
|
||||||
|
|
||||||
|
@ -77,7 +72,10 @@ class ReadLikes:
|
||||||
result = json.loads(result)
|
result = json.loads(result)
|
||||||
totalLikes = result['hits']['total']
|
totalLikes = result['hits']['total']
|
||||||
totalValue = result['aggregations']['level_sum']['value']
|
totalValue = result['aggregations']['level_sum']['value']
|
||||||
score = totalValue/totalLikes
|
if totalLikes:
|
||||||
|
score = totalValue/totalLikes
|
||||||
|
else:
|
||||||
|
score = 0
|
||||||
raw = result['hits']['hits']
|
raw = result['hits']['hits']
|
||||||
finalPrint = {}
|
finalPrint = {}
|
||||||
finalPrint['likes'] = []
|
finalPrint['likes'] = []
|
||||||
|
|
Loading…
Reference in New Issue